Job description

The Mom Project is excited to partner with a well-established CPA firm located near Chicago, IL. We are seeking an experienced Tax Accountant to join their growing team. This opportunity is available on either a full-time or part-time basis, depending on the needs of the candidate.

This role offers exceptional flexibility and a true family-first culture. While there is hybrid flexibility, candidates must be local to the area and able to work onsite at least 2-3 days per week. The firm values face-to-face collaboration and relationship building, while providing flexibility to accommodate family and personal commitments.


Location: ZIP Code 60561


Responsibilities

· Prepare and review individual (1040), partnership (1065), corporate (1120), S-Corporation (1120S), and trust tax returns

· Research tax issues and apply current tax laws and regulations to client situations

· Work directly with clients to gather information, answer questions, and provide tax-related guidance

· Manage multiple client engagements while meeting deadlines and maintaining high-quality work

· Identify tax planning opportunities and potential risks for clients

· Communicate in a timely, accurate, positive, and professional manner

· Establish and maintain strong client relationships through regular communication

· Collaborate with team members to ensure client needs are met and deadlines are achieved

· Proactively identify process improvements and opportunities to enhance efficiency

· Support a diverse client base, including business owners, high-net-worth individuals, trusts, franchises, and other complex tax entities
